    Current events

    Templar and the other minions of Harvest have recently taken on the Teen Titans and the Legion Lost. Templar was then defeated by the two teams.

    Origin

    Templar is the leader of an organization known as N.O.W.H.E.R.E. With the world still adapting to the emergence of super heroes, aliens and metahumans, Templar and N.O.W.H.E.R.E. seek to control the young adolescent heroes that have been popping up all over the world, feeling that the older more adult heroes are far past the point of being able to be controlled. In order to accomplish this, Templar organizes the creation of his ultimate weapon, Superboy, a clone of Jon Kent. He seeks to use Superboy against the first major threat that rears it's head towards him, the Teen Titans, lead by Tim Drake.

    Creation

    In DC Comics' "New 52" continuity relaunch following Flashpoint, Templar was created by Superboy and Teen Titans writer Scott Lobdell for the Culling.

    Teen Titans: It's Our Right to Fight

    For more information see: Teen Titans: It's Our Right to Fight

    While staying at Lex Towers, Red Robin is ambushed by Templar and a squad of NOWHERE soldiers, but Red Robin gets away by jumping out the window and blowing up the apartment behind him. Later Templar is seen with Fairchild demanding that she release Superboy to capture Wonder Girl. Later, when Superboy is awake and watching holograms of Wonder Girl, Templar orders Fairchild to stay out of his way.

    When Superboy confronts the Teen Titans for the first time, it is Templar the NOWHERE soldier turn to for advise on how to deal with the team. Templar orders them to observe only and not to bother him again. But when Superboy goes rouge it is Templar orders that take him down. And when Wonder Girl and the rest of the Teen Titans come to Superboy's aide it is Templar who fight her after she defeated Ravager. He is defeated when Wonder Girl siphons his life essence out with her lariat

    The Culling

    For more information see: The Culling

    Templar shows up at the Culling with the rest of the Ravengers. He is later seen being defeated by Wonder Girl, again.

    Powers and Abilities

    Templar has the ability to change his intestines into vicious, blood-thirsty, snake-like creatures, he uses these to kill his enemies.
